DETAILED CIRCUIT DESCRIPTIONS
2.4.1
Power Supply
When in its default configuration, the evaluation board requires only one external power
supply, typically a +5.0V single supply voltage applied to pin 3 (or 4) of the 4-pin screw
terminal J2. The ground connection (GND) should be made to pin 1 of J2; see
The LEDs D1 and D2 will indicate that power is applied to the V
DUT
and VS+ supplies.
FIGURE 2-2:
Power Supply Circuit and Connections.
The power plane of the evaluation board is separated into two segments: one labeled
V
DUT
and one VS+. The V
DUT
supply line mainly powers the
MCP6N16
instrumentation
amplifier. It is also connected to be the supply rail for any attached bridge sensor (VB+,
VB-). The VS+ supply powers the precision voltage reference MCP1525, and the
Zero-Drift op-amp MCP6V11.
The evaluation board is also preconfigured to be operated from a +3.3V supply rail
when connected up to a PIC
®
microcontroller. Jumper 8 is needed to make this
connection, while any external lab supplies must be disconnected from the power
connector J2.
In addition to connecting the supply voltages, pin 2 of terminal J2 can be used to apply
an external common-mode voltage (V
CM
) for biasing the inputs of the instrumentation
amplifier
MCP6N16
(see
). Further details on this function can be found in
Section 2.4.3 “Instrumentation Amplifier”
.
Note 1:
Jumper J1 is installed by default and therefore shorts the V
DUT
and VS+
supply voltage connections together. In this configuration, the evaluation
board can be operated with full functionality within a voltage range of
+2.7V to +5.5V.
2:
Removing jumper J1 will necessitate a second external power supply to
maintain full operation of the evaluation board. This will allow the
MCP6N16 to be operated over its full supply range of +1.8V to +5.5V. The
VS+ supply should not be lower than +2.7V, in order to maintain operation
of the +2.5V precision reference IC MCP1525.
